## Documentation Index Access the complete documentation index at: https://www.zoho.com/us/books/help/llms.txt Use this file to discover all available documentation pages before proceeding. # Enable Zoho Inventory Add-ons The default inventory management feature in Zoho Books lets you track stock, set preferred vendors to items, set reorder points, and adjust inventory. With the Zoho Inventory add-on, you can perform advanced inventory management using modules like Composite Items, Packages, Shipments, and more, all within Zoho Books. **Prerequisite:** You must have a paid Zoho Inventory organization to enable Zoho Inventory add-ons in Zoho Books. **Note:** This feature is available only in certain plans of Zoho Books. To enable the Zoho Inventory add-on: * Go to **Settings**. * Select **General** under _Setup & Configurations_ in _Organisation Settings_. * Scroll down to the _Zoho Inventory Add-on_, and check **Enable Zoho Inventory modules in Zoho Books**. ![Enable Inventory Add-ons](/books/help/images/items/enable-addon.png) * In the _Enable Zoho Inventory Add-on_ pop-up, review the information and click **Enable**. * Click **Save** at the bottom of the page. The Zoho Inventory add-on will be enabled for your organisation, and you will have access to the following modules: ## Composite Items A composite item is a single product that you create by combining two or more items. There are two types of composite items: * **Assemblies**: Use this when you physically combine multiple items into one finished product. This works well for manufacturers and businesses that produce finished goods. * **Kits**: Use this when you group items together and sell them as a single unit without physically assembling them. This works well for gift sets, product combos, and more. You can also set custom prices for kits. **Scenario:** Zylker Electronics manufactures laptop bundles. Each bundle includes a laptop, a laptop bag, and a wireless mouse. Instead of selling these items separately, they create a composite item called **Laptop Starter Kit** using the _Assembly_ type. When a customer purchases this kit, Zoho Books automatically tracks the stock of all three components, ensuring accurate inventory management. To create a composite item: * Go to _Items_ on the left sidebar and select **Composite Items**. * Click **\+ New** in the top right corner. * In the _New Composite Item_ page, fill in the required details. ![Composite Items](/books/help/images/items/composite-items.png) * Click **Save**. The composite item will be created. Learn more about [Composite Items](https://www.zoho.com/inventory/help/items/composite-items.html). ## Packages A package lets you group items from a sales order and assign a package slip number to them. You can use it to track your consignments as you ship them to your customer. **Prerequisites:** * The sales order must be confirmed. * You must have the package slip numbers for your physical packages. The statuses of a package include: **Status** **Description** **Not Shipped** The package is created but has not been shipped yet. **Shipped** The package moves to this status when you create a shipment order for it. **Delivered** The package reaches this status when it is delivered to the customer. You can also manually mark a package as delivered for a manual shipment. To create a package: * Go to _Inventory_ on the left sidebar and select **Packages**. * Click **\+ New** in the top right corner. * In the _New Package_ page, fill in the required details. * Click **Save**. The package will be recorded. Learn more about [Purchase Receives](https://www.zoho.com/inventory/help/purchase-receives/purchase-receives.html). ![Purchase Receives](/books/help/images/items/purchase-receives.png) ## Sales Returns A sales return is a process where a seller accepts a purchased item back from a customer. In return, the customer receives a credit, cash return, or a replacement. Common reasons for a sales return include damaged or expired product, incorrect delivery, and more. To create a sales return: * Go to _Sales_ on the left sidebar and select **Sales Orders**. * Select the sales order for which you want to record a sales return. * Click the **Create** dropdown at the top of the page and select **Sales Return**. * Fill in the required details. * Click **Save**. The sales return will be recorded. Learn more about [Transfer Orders](https://www.zoho.com/inventory/help/transfer-orders/transfer-orders.html). ## Replenishments Replenishments help your business maintain right stock levels by identifying items that needs to be reordered. When an item reaches it’s reorder level, it is listed under Pending Replenishments. From there, you can create purchase orders or transfer orders and replenish the stocks. To enable Replenishments in Zoho Books: * Go to **Settings**. * Under _Module Settings_, select **Items** under _General_. * In the next page, scroll down and enable the toggle next to _Replenishments_. * **Select how you would like to replenish the stock:** Choose the frequency to replenish the stocks in your organization. The available options are **Days**, **Weeks**, and **Months**. * **Schedule at:** Choose the time you want to replenish the stocks. * **Include Yet to Receive and In Transit stock along with available for sale to generate replenishment tasks:** Enable this option if you want to include these stocks for replenishment tasks. * Click **Save**. ![Replenishments](/books/help/images/items/replenishment.png)
